元素地球化学示踪技术在康定大渡河金矿田中的应用探讨

摘要 分析康定大渡河流域金矿床开发的相关背景,指出开展绿色勘查是有效实现金矿开发与生态环境保护和谐共存的重要手段。元素地球化学示踪技术作为重要的绿色勘查方法之一,在康定大渡河流域金矿中的应用主要表现在矿床成因研究和深部资源探测两个方面,并通过矿床实例进行了验证。研究表明,元素地球化学示踪技术不仅可以应用于绿色勘查,而且可以应用于绿色矿业中的重金属污染治理、矿山地质环境恢复等方面;不仅可以用来研究地球、月球、火星等天体的形成和演化,而且可以与同位素技术结合起来为灾变事件提供有力的证据。在大渡河流域进行绿色矿业开发的同时,协同发展关联产业,如此才能走可持续发展道路。 This paper analyzes the background of gold deposit development in Dadu River Basin of Kangding,and points out that green exploration is an important means to realize the harmonious coexistence of gold exploitation and ecological environment protection.As one of the important green exploration methods,the application of element geochemical tracing technology in gold deposits in Daduhe River Basin of Kangding is mainly manifested in two aspects of deposit genesis research and deep resource exploration,which is verified by an example of the deposit.The research shows that element geochemical tracing technology can not only be applied to green exploration,but also to heavy metal pollution control and mine geological environment restoration in green mining.it can not only be used to study the formation and evolution of earth,moon,Mars and other celestial bodies,but also can be combined with isotope technology to provide strong evidence for catastrophic events.While developing green mining in Dadu River Basin,we should coordinate the development of related industries,so as to take the road of sustainable development.
